Goldberg makes surprise Bromley return

Mark Goldberg has returned to take charge of Blue Square South Bromley having quit the club for "family reasons" at the turn of the year.

The former Crystal Palace owner agreed to return following a board meeting on Sunday night.

He takes the reins from former Palace and Gillingham midfielder Simon Osborn who succeeded him.

Club secretary Colin Russell confirmed: "Mark agreed to return following Sunday's meeting. But I don't think he ever really left because he was coming to games and even turned up when we played at Bognor.

"He led the club into Blue Square South so I'm sure his return will be welcomed by supporters."
